One prophet's been recognised in his own kingdom

This very entertaining interview with Robert Forster, formerly of The Go-Betweens, reveals that a major bridge in Australia has been named after the band, which is cool as well as a good pun.

The Go-Betweens are fixed stars in my musical universe. Other bands come and go in my estimation, but there's always a Go-Betweens song (or a solo one by MacLennan or Forster) to suit the occasion.
